Surreptitious(a.)祕密的;暗中的

definition: marked by quiet and caution and secrecy; taking pains to avoid being observed; "a furtive manner"; "a sneak attack";

Incontrovertible(a.)無疑的

definition: Not controvertible; too clear or certain to admit of dispute;indisputable

Dismantle(v.)分解

definition:

     1. To strip or deprive of dress; to divest.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. To strip of furniture and equipments, guns, etc.; to
        unrig; to strip of walls or outworks; to break down; as,
        to dismantle a fort, a town, or a ship.
        [1913 Webster]
  
              A dismantled house, without windows or shutters to
              keep out the rain.                    --Macaulay.
        [1913 Webster]

Sumptuous(a.)奢侈的

definition:   rich and superior in quality; "a princely sum"; "gilded
             dining rooms" [syn: {deluxe}, {gilded}, {grand},
             {luxurious}, {opulent}, {princely}, {sumptuous}]

Parsimonious(a.)節儉的

definition:   excessively unwilling to spend; "parsimonious thrift
             relieved by few generous impulses"; "lived in a most
             penurious manner--denying himself every indulgence" [syn:
             {parsimonious}, {penurious}]

Pedagogue (n.)教師

definition:
     1. (Gr. Antiq.) A slave who led his master's children to
        school, and had the charge of them generally.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. A teacher of children; one whose occupation is to teach
        the young; a schoolmaster.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     3. One who by teaching has become formal, positive, or
        pedantic in his ways; one who has the manner of a
        schoolmaster; a pedant.

Anthropologist(n.)學者

definition: a social scientist who specializes in anthropology

Incompatibility(n.)不兩立;不相容

definition:
      1: the relation between propositions that cannot both be true
           at the same time [syn: {incompatibility}, {mutual
           exclusiveness}, {inconsistency}, {repugnance}]
      2: (immunology) the degree to which the body's immune system
         will try to reject foreign material (as transfused blood or
         transplanted tissue)
      3: the quality of being unable to exist or work in congenial
         combination [ant: {compatibility}]

platitude(n.)單調;陳腐

definition:

    1. The quality or state of being flat, thin, or insipid; flat
        commonness; triteness; staleness of ideas of language.
        [1913 Webster]
  
              To hammer one golden grain of wit into a sheet of
              infinite platitude.                   --Motley.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. A thought or remark which is flat, dull, trite, or weak; a
        truism; a commonplace.
        [1913 Webster]

Dispersed(a.)分散的

definition:

   1. To scatter abroad; to drive to different parts; to
        distribute; to diffuse; to spread; as, the Jews are
        dispersed among all nations.
        [1913 Webster]
  
              The lips of the wise disperse knowledge. --Prov. xv.
                                                    7.
        [1913 Webster]
  
              Two lions, in the still, dark night,
              A herd of beeves disperse.            --Cowper.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. To scatter, so as to cause to vanish; to dissipate; as, to
        disperse vapors.
        [1913 Webster]
  
              Dispersed are the glories.            --Shak.

Vehement(a.)熱烈的

definition:

1. Acting with great force; furious; violent; impetuous;
        forcible; mighty; as, a vehement wind; a vehement torrent;
        a vehement fire or heat.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. Very ardent; very eager or urgent; very fervent;
        passionate; as, a vehement affection or passion. "Vehement
        instigation." --Shak. "Vehement desire." --Milton.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     Syn: Furious; violent; raging; impetuous; passionate; ardent;
          eager; hot; fervid; burning.
          [1913 Webster]

Chicanery(n.)強詞奪理

definition:

the use of tricks to deceive someone (usually to extract money from them) [syn: {trickery}, {chicanery}, {chicane},{guile}, {wile}, {shenanigan}]
